2. Puppy dog close
It s one of the simplest, yet actionable and effective sales closing techniques. To enact it, you need to allow your prospects to test drive your product, whatever it might be.
The actual feeling of possessing or trying the thing they like makes them happy and satisfied. As a result they want to buy it from you.
3. Assumptive close
Assuming that your sale will close is a powerful and highly effective technique. The only thing you have to do is to be as uber confident as possible in your product and yourself.

This technique presupposes using a phrase that assumes the close is a done deal. You can create a set of your own assertive statements to resort to them whenever necessary.
E. g., What day do you want to receive your order?
4. Question close
A good idea is to ask a series of probing questions during the negotiations, to eliminate all objections to buy, or try to close the sale with a question.
The sales rep can address objections and gain a commitment. Asking questions is a win win situation. Questions urge people to act and help you discover whether your product appeals to your customers.
E. g., Is there anything preventing you from agreeing to this deal today?
5. Analytics close
Historians say Benjamin Franklin made decisions in the following way he created a list with two columns pros and cons and based his choice on the longer one.
If you have clients who are analytical personalities by their nature, you ll benefit from compiling lists of your product s advantages and disadvantages too in advance; then offer your customers the perigo to make their own decision.
6. Now or never close
This is a classic. To entice into buying those tough customers of yours who are still hesitating, offer them a special benefit discount, gift, bonus, attractive quotes etc..
The efficacy of this technique is based on the following psychological mechanism people are often afraid to commit, even if they want what you offer them, perto matter what it is.
Zilches, simplify the process of taking a decision for them to your advantage. E. g., If you sign up today, I can offer 25 discount.
7. Urgency close
It s recommended to create a sense of urgency that places pressure on the prospect and forces them to make a purchasing decision. But you are to be well versed in timing and pacing, not to commit serious mistakes as for the timeframes your clients can operate within.
E. g., This is a limited time offer that is valid till the end of the day.
8. Empathy close
Emotions possess immense power. To reel your customers in, you re more than welcome to use emotions and empathy, leaving reason in the backseat. It s recommended to relate your product s benefits and the aspects of customers problems. Showing them that you care about their pain will put you on the right track.
